我正在使用CentOS。我从rpm安装了Java8。
在本教程之后,我做了以下操作:
导出JAVA_HOME=jdk-install-dir 导出路径=$JAVA_HOME/bin:$PATH
然而,当我断开与SSH的连接时,它已经消失了。如何将上述内容保存到.bash_profile中?我相信这是解决这个问题的最佳方法。
遵循本教程:
谢谢!
发布于 2016-05-16 15:42:41
如果要永久设置环境变量,可以将export命令行写入/etc/profile.d/ (用于系统范围的更改)或~/..bash_profile(用于本地用户)。
注意:每当打开一个新的终端(在登录用户之后),bashrc就会被执行。
bash_profile将在用户登录时执行(无论是通过ssh还是实际坐在计算机前)
您始终可以在一个文件中导出envvars,通过在另一个文件中获取该文件,您将在登录/非登录shell中获得这些envvars:
#If you exported the envvars in bash_profile
if [ -f ~/.bashrc ]; then
source ~/.bashrc
fi希望它对你有帮助
https://stackoverflow.com/questions/37257584
复制相似问题